Stop At: Detlev-Rohwedder-Haus, Wilhelmstraße 97, 10117 Berlin, Germany

At the time of its construction, it was the largest office building in Europe. It was constructed in1936 to house the German Ministry of Aviation (Reichsluftfahrtministerium, or RLM), headed by Hermann Göring.
